Abstract
The pathological analysis of a breast cancer requires a thorough macroscopic and histological examination to assess the conventional prognostic factors of size, type, grade and a careful search of vascular invasions and of lymph node infiltration. Additional immunostainings are useful to determine the estradiol and progesterone receptors content of the tumour, as well as its HER2 status and its proliferating index. E-cadherin and subtypes of cytokeratin immunostainings may help in difficult cases to precise the histological type of the tumour. A selection of new prognostic factors is also presented.
